Description

Public utility facilities; approval procedures. Provides that an appeal from a decision of the State Corporation Commission approving or denying the construction and operation of an electrical generating facility not larger than 50 megawatts may proceed by a petition for appeal to the Supreme Court. Currently, parties in interest or aggrieved parties may appeal the Commission's decision as a matter of right. The measure also clarifies that a local governing body may authorize the construction or establishment of a public utility facility or public service corporation facility, and certain other public improvements, prior to the planning commission's determination that the facility is in accord with the comprehensive plan, if the governing body conditions its approval on a finding by the planning commission that it is in substantial accord with the comprehensive plan.
